Claudia Maria Hattinger is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Claudia Maria Hattinger has authored 68 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 36 papers in Molecular Biology, 33 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 21 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Claudia Maria Hattinger’s work include Sarcoma Diagnosis and Treatment (30 papers),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(14 papers) and Cancer therapeutics and mechanisms (11 papers). Claudia Maria Hattinger is often cited by papers focused on Sarcoma Diagnosis and Treatment (30 papers),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(14 papers) and Cancer therapeutics and mechanisms (11 papers). Claudia Maria Hattinger coll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Austria and The Netherlands. Claudia Maria Hattinger's co-authors include Massimo Serra, Piero Picci, Katia Scotlandi, Michela Pasello, Marilù Fanelli, Elisa Tavanti, Peter F. Ambros, Francesca Michelacci, Chiara Riganti and Maria Pia Patrizio and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Cancer Research and Clinical Cancer Research.
